The world in the dark - how night animals see

A real scorpion, fluorescent minerals and a fascinating thermal imaging camera - this year's Long Night of Munich Museums is all about the perception of nocturnal animals in the joint program of the Museum Mensch und Natur and BIOTOPIA. Experts from the museum and BIOTOPIA will be on hand, along with numerous stations where you can participate and try things out for yourself.

Which nocturnal animals are there? Why is the owl a true sensory wonder? And how are light and vision connected? During the community program, which takes place in the Museum Mensch und Natur, we will deal with these and many other questions about the optical perception of other creatures and learn, among other things, what our world looks like in UV or infrared light.

In addition, of course, the exhibition highlights of the museum, "classics" such as the popular wheel of fortune or geode cracking and insights into the concept of BIOTOPIA are waiting: All are invited to discover life!
